Output 63b7184108f6185820e3599b97cda0f6f90d9bf674dbc8862ac4708da91cce0a:1

value
21877640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c881d39e6f38c18acd9a2628fc19ce260f1741 OP_EQUAL
address
3QBtMDNG2JeVo8sSVNpm3ETaAjWH4h44C4
transaction
63b7184108f6185820e3599b97cda0f6f90d9bf674dbc8862ac4708da91cce0a
spent
true